witting noun. obsolete exc. Scot. & dial. ME.
[Partly from Old Norse vitand (in at minni, varri, etc., vitand to my, our, etc. knowledge); partly from WIT verb + -ING1.]
The fact of knowing or being aware of something; knowledge, cognizance. Freq. in at one's witting, by one's witting, of one's witting, to one's witting, to or with one's knowledge; as (far as) one knows. ME.
sing. & (usu.) in pl. Knowledge obtained or (esp.) communicated; information, intelligence, news; notice, warning. Chiefly in get witting(s), have witting(s). LME.
